What is Dermaplaning?

Dermaplaning is a non-invasive exfoliation technique that involves using a surgical scalpel to gently remove the top layer of dead skin cells and vellus hair (commonly known as "peach fuzz") from the face. This procedure aims to reveal a smoother, brighter complexion by effectively getting rid of the buildup of dead skin cells and fine facial hair. During the treatment, a trained esthetician or dermatologist carefully glides the scalpel across the skin, exfoliating the surface and promoting cellular turnover. Dermaplaning can help improve the appearance of uneven skin texture, fine lines, and superficial scars. It also allows for better product absorption and smoother makeup application. The procedure is typically painless and has no downtime, making it a popular choice for those seeking a quick and effective way to achieve a radiant, rejuvenated complexion.
